3. EFQM today in France

The foregoing benchmarks would seem to lend credence to the thesis that EFQM is of great interest. However, if we take a factual approach – recommended in the concepts, since the inception of the – reference framework, it has to be said that the approach has not really caught on in France. The foundation reports 30,000 users in Europe, including 500 members (counting those in the Middle East). Applying a ratio of 20% to these figures (approximate ratio of GDP France/Europe), we would have 6,000 user organizations and 100 members. The list on the EFQM website mentions some fifteen members in France, and the estimated number of companies or organizations practicing the approach is put at a few hundred... Could it be that France is allergic to the approach, or has it developed a phobia of TQM (Total Quality Management) over the years? The fact is, we're not known for our enthusiasm for management...
